Flexible connection pluggable cold head container structure

By using a flexible, pluggable cold head container structure, the problem of difficult replacement of magnet cooling components is solved, enabling rapid disassembly and assembly and cold source transfer, reducing energy consumption and protecting the magnet.

Abstract

The utility model discloses a flexible connection pluggable cold head container structure, and relates to the superconducting magnet refrigeration technology. Comprising a magnet Dewar vacuum cavity and an independent cold head container vacuum cavity; the cold head container assembly is connected with a first multi-stage cold seat and a second multi-stage cold seat through a first-stage thin-walled pipe, a second-stage thin-walled pipe and a flexible corrugated pipe correspondingly, flexible displacement compensation of axial cold shrinkage of the refrigerator cold head is achieved in combination with a spring pre-tightening structure, and it is ensured that the cold energy transmission contact face is tight. The refrigerating machine assembly is quickly inserted and pulled out through the bolt and the compression spring, the vacuum cavity of the cold head container is isolated from the vacuum cavity of the magnet Dewar during disassembly and assembly, the vacuum cavity of the magnet Dewar does not need to be damaged, the low-temperature state of the magnet does not need to be damaged, the replacement and work period is greatly shortened, and energy consumption is reduced.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to superconducting magnet refrigeration technology, concretely is a kind of flexible connection pluggable cold head container structure. BACKGROUND

[0002] The existing magnet refrigeration assembly is mostly fixed structure, and the magnet refrigerator is difficult to replace, with large workload, long cold head replacement and maintenance period, and the magnet needs to be rewarming, vacuum breaking and cutting for maintenance, and then reassembled, welded, vacuumed and cooled down.The whole working cycle is long, the workload is large, and the magnet may be damaged to some extent;

[0003] And the existing pluggable cold head container structure mostly adopts plane contact type installation, and increases flexible contact by indium pad or indium welding between primary heat transfer block and primary cold seat, which needs to replace and process indium pad every time to ensure the elasticity of indium layer when replacing the refrigeration unit, and the secondary installation is also mostly in this form, which is more complicated to operate, and the cold head contact piece will be cold contracted during magnet cooling, causing contact disengagement and forming large contact thermal resistance, affecting cooling realization.Therefore, we provide a kind of flexible connection pluggable cold head container structure. DETAILED DESCRIPTION

[0025] In order to further explain the technical means and effects adopted by the utility model to achieve the predetermined utility model purposes, the specific embodiments, structures, features and effects according to the utility model are described in detail as follows by combining with the drawings and preferred embodiments.

[0026] Please refer to Figures 1-6As shown, a flexible connection plug-in cold head container structure includes a magnet Dewar vacuum cavity 10 composed of a Dewar 5 and a cold head container vacuum cavity 9 composed of a cold head container assembly 3, and the cold head container assembly 3 is welded and fixed with the Dewar 5 through a Dewar diameter pipe 4, so as to form a 300K temperature gradient; the middle part of the cold head container assembly 3 is bolted with a 50K cold screen 7 in the magnet Dewar vacuum cavity 10 through a first-level thermal connection, so as to form a 50K temperature gradient; the bottom of the cold head container assembly 3 is a second-level cold seat 306, the second-level cold seat 306 is bolted with a cold mass magnet 8, so as to form a 4K temperature gradient;

[0027] The cold head container assembly 3 includes a cold head container seat 301, a first-level cold seat 303 and a second-level cold seat 306, the cold head container seat 301 is fixed with the Dewar diameter pipe 4, and the cold head container seat 301 and the first-level cold seat 303 below are connected through a first-level thin-walled pipe 302 and a first-level cold seat 303 brazing connection to ensure the structural strength and reduce heat leakage; the first-level cold seat 303 and the second-level cold seat 306 are sequentially connected with a second-level thin-walled pipe 304 and a flexible bellows 305, which can not only reduce heat leakage, but also ensure flexible displacement compensation during the axial cold contraction of the second-level thin-walled pipe 304, and the connection is stable, which ensures the strength of the second-level thin-walled pipe 304; more, the second-level thin-walled pipe 304 and the flexible bellows 305 are sealed and welded, and the connection ends of the two and the corresponding cold seat are sealed and welded by brazing.

[0028] A refrigerator assembly 1 is installed in the inner cavity of the cold head container assembly 3, and the two are fixed through a connecting seat assembly 2, the connecting seat assembly 2 includes a refrigerator connecting seat 204 matched and installed with the cold head container seat 301, and the two are connected through a plurality of connecting bolts 201, the connecting bolts 201 are provided with compression springs 202 outside the periphery to provide pre-tightening force, and O-rings 203 are arranged at the positions where the side walls of the cold head container seat 301 and the refrigerator connecting seat 204 are in contact to provide sealing;

[0029] The first-level cold head 101 of the refrigerator assembly 1 is conically contacted and matched with the first-level cold seat 303 through a first-level heat transfer block 102, and the second-level cold head 103 of the refrigerator assembly 1 is conically contacted and matched with the second-level cold seat 306 through a second-level heat transfer block assembly 104;

[0030] Specifically, the secondary heat transfer assembly 104 comprises a secondary cold head connecting block 1041 kept in abutment at the bottom of the secondary cold head 103, a plurality of connecting guide shafts 1043 are fixed at the bottom of the secondary cold head connecting block 1041, a secondary conical heat transfer block 1044 is slidably connected at the bottom of the plurality of connecting guide shafts 1043, and a secondary flexible spring 1048 is sleeved on the outer periphery of each connecting guide shaft 1043, the two ends of the secondary flexible spring 1048 are in abutment with the secondary conical heat transfer block 1044 and the secondary cold head connecting block 1041 respectively, so that the secondary conical heat transfer block 1044 is always in contact with the secondary cold seat 306; in addition, a flexible heat connection 1042 is arranged between the secondary conical heat transfer block 1044 and the secondary cold head connecting block 1041 to complete the cold source transmission, and a secondary cold head radiation shield 1045 is further arranged outside the secondary heat transfer block assembly 104.

[0031] In the cooling working state of the refrigeration machine, the primary cold head 101 of the refrigeration machine will be axially cold contracted, so that a gap is formed between the primary heat transfer block 102 and the primary cold seat 303, the contact area is reduced, the contact thermal resistance is increased, and the cold quantity transmission is obstructed; at this time, the connecting bolt 201 is screwed in, the compression spring 202 is compressed, and then the primary heat transfer block 102 is compressed axially downward, so that the primary cold seat 303 is in re-compressed contact after cooling, so as to ensure the primary cold conduction and the effective transmission of the cold source.

[0032] Similarly, the secondary cold head 103 of the refrigeration machine will be axially cold contracted, so that a gap is formed between the secondary heat transfer block 1044 and the secondary cold seat 306, the contact area is reduced, the contact thermal resistance is increased, and the cold quantity transmission is obstructed; at this time, under the elastic compensation of the secondary flexible spring 1048 and the guiding action of the connecting guide shaft 1043, the secondary conical heat transfer block 1044 always keeps close contact with the secondary cold seat 306, so as to overcome the contact separation caused by the cold contraction in the refrigeration process of the cold head of the refrigeration machine, and protect the cooling process of the secondary cold head 103.

[0033] Since the connection forms between the primary cold seat 303 and the secondary cold seat 306 of the refrigeration machine assembly 1 and the cold head container assembly 3 are all contact connections, only the connecting bolt 201 on the refrigeration machine connecting seat 204 needs to be adjusted to complete the separation of the refrigeration machine assembly 1 and the cold head container assembly 3, so that the plug-in disassembly of the refrigeration machine is completed; and in the disassembly process, since there is an independent cold head container vacuum cavity 9, the vacuum condition of the magnet Dewar vacuum cavity 10 is not considered to be damaged by the disassembly operation.
